The NJM4560M is an operational amplifier that amplifies and processes analog signals. It consists of multiple transistors and resistors configured to provide amplification with low noise and high accuracy. The op-amp operates by comparing the voltage difference between its input terminals and amplifying this difference to produce an output signal.

Question: What is NJM4560M?
- Answer: NJM4560M is a dual operational amplifier (op-amp) that is commonly used in audio applications.
Question: What is the voltage supply range for NJM4560M?
- Answer: The voltage supply range for NJM4560M is typically between ±4V and ±18V.
Question: What is the input impedance of NJM4560M?
- Answer: The input impedance of NJM4560M is typically around 5 megaohms.
Question: Can NJM4560M be used as a voltage follower?
- Answer: Yes, NJM4560M can be used as a voltage follower by connecting the output directly to the inverting input.
Question: What is the gain bandwidth product of NJM4560M?
- Answer: The gain bandwidth product of NJM4560M is typically around 10 MHz.
Question: Can NJM4560M be used in low noise applications?
- Answer: Yes, NJM4560M has low noise characteristics and can be used in low noise applications.
Question: Is NJM4560M suitable for audio signal amplification?
- Answer: Yes, NJM4560M is commonly used for audio signal amplification due to its low distortion and high slew rate.
Question: Can NJM4560M operate in a single-supply configuration?
- Answer: Yes, NJM4560M can operate in a single-supply configuration by connecting the non-inverting input to a reference voltage.
Question: What is the output current capability of NJM4560M?
- Answer: The output current capability of NJM4560M is typically around 20 mA.
Question: Can NJM4560M be used in active filter circuits?
- Answer: Yes, NJM4560M can be used in active filter circuits due to its high gain and low noise characteristics.
